Kil Municipality
Kil Municipality is a municipality in Värmland County in west central Sweden. Its seat is located in the town of Kil. The local government reform of 1971 amalgamated Stora Kil, Järnskog and a part of Brunskog, thus forming Kil Municipality.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Fryksdalen, or Fryk Valley is a region in Värmland, surrounding the three lakes known as Fryken. Administratively, it is constituted by the three municipalities Kil, Sunne, and Torsby.
Fagerås
Village
Fagerås is a locality situated in Kil Municipality, Värmland County, Sweden, with 427 inhabitants in 2010. Fagerås is situated 6 km west of Kil Municipality.
